The Evolution of Lady Gaga’s Advertising Strategies

To truly get Lady Gagas ad choices, we need to look back. How have her strategies grown over time? Its quite a journey. She first hit the scene with The Fame in 2008. Remember those days? Radio and TV were big for music back then. But as she got famous, Gaga changed fast. She moved with new tech. Thats just what she does, honestly. Shes always one step ahead.

Social media changed everything for her. It was a big deal. In 2009, she jumped on Twitter and Facebook early. She was one of the first major artists. Thats pretty cool. She has 84.3 million Twitter followers. Instagram has 60 million. Think about that reach. She talks to fans right away. This helps her share new music or tour dates. It builds a community. Her brand really connects. Pew Research says 72% of American adults use social media. This shows how many people artists can reach. Its a huge audience.

But heres the thing: its not just about numbers. These platforms work in deeper ways. A 2018 report showed something. Global Web Index found most people found music through social media. Thats a powerful thought. Gaga uses social media very wisely. This helps her stay important and successful. Shes always in the game.

Social Media: The Powerhouse of Promotion

Lady Gagas preference for social media as an advertising medium cannot be overstated. Her Instagram shows more than just music. It shows her art. You see her fashion sense, too. Plus, her personal thoughts. This layered way she shares connects with her fans. It just works. To be honest, its cool how she uses social media. Not just for ads. She talks about important things. Mental health, LGBTQ+ rights, for example. Thats advocacy, plain and simple. Its inspiring to witness.

Think of her hit song Shallow from A Star is Born. It was a hit. Gaga used Instagram Stories then. She shared behind-the-scenes glimpses. Fans saw rehearsal bits. This built huge excitement for them. Its no secret that people love engagement. A Sprout Social report proves it. Images get 650% more engagement. Thats compared to text-only posts. Gaga understands this well. She uses it like a pro.

Her social media plan actually shows results. We can measure them. In 2020, she put out Chromatica. She had huge online events. Virtual performances were part of it. The album hit number one. It was on the Billboard 200 list. Over 300,000 copies sold right away. Those first-week sales are impressive. They show her campaigns really work.

Music Videos: A Visual Spectacle

Lady Gaga is amazing at music videos too. Theyre another ad tool. Her videos arent just ads, though. Theyre art, pure and simple. They often question how society thinks. Just look at Bad Romance. It came out in 2009. It got over 1.3 billion YouTube views. The pictures are just stunning. Its themes touch on love and fame. Identity is there too. All these ideas define Gagas brand.

Remember 2019? She put out Stupid Love. That video had bright colors. It felt like the future. It was a huge hit right away. It got 61 million views in a week. This tells you something important. Her music videos do more than sell songs. They build a whole visual world. Fans want to be in that world.

Vevo says music videos are big. They are over half of YouTubes views. So Gagas beautiful videos pay off. She spends money on them. They keep her music seen by many people. She stays relevant always.

Collaborations and Brand Partnerships

Lady Gaga uses collaborations well. Brand partnerships are smart moves. Shes worked with many brands. This helps her spread her message. Think of her Bud Light tie-up. That was during Coachella in 2017. That was a big marketing moment. Gaga was the main act there. It promoted her music for sure. It also made Bud Light seem cool. It showed Bud Light was connected to culture. Very clever, right?

Her makeup brand, Haus Laboratories, is a hit. Its truly amazing. The brand is about expressing yourself. Thats a big part of Gagas art. Haus Laboratories launched in 2019. It made over $3 million fast. That was just in the first week. It shows her brand fits her products. Its a perfect match, I believe. Her personal touch makes it work.

A 2021 study found something interesting. Consumers like story-filled brand collaborations. The American Marketing Association shared it. 73% of people felt this way. Gagas partnerships do exactly this. They tell stories her audience connects with. This storytelling makes her ads real. They fit her art perfectly.

The Role of Live Performances and Tours

Live shows are key for Lady Gagas ads. They are super important. Concerts and tours arent just for singing. Theyre also for selling. She promotes albums and merchandise there. Her 2017 Joanne tour shows this. It made over $95 million. Thats a lot of money, honestly. It shows live events help promote her work. They bring in big cash.

During her shows, Gaga uses visuals. She adds special lighting and costumes. These reflect who she is. Its a feast for your senses. Audiences are totally captivated. They make lasting memories there. Eventbrite research found something interesting. 78% of younger people want experiences. They prefer that over buying things. Gaga knows this feeling well. Her live shows arent just concerts. Theyre cherished experiences for fans. Imagine yourself at one of her shows. What an amazing night.

Album launches and tours work together. This makes them even better. When Chromatica came out, she announced a tour. They linked up. This smart timing keeps the buzz high. People stay excited about her music. It’s a great example of cross-promotion. She uses many tools to get seen.

The Impact of Traditional Media

You might think Gaga only uses new ads. But old ways still matter. Traditional media helps her a lot. TV shows, interviews, and magazines. These reach a wider group of people. They are very important channels. Think of her Saturday Night Live visits. They boost her streaming numbers. Her latest songs get a huge jump. Thats a classic marketing move.

Nielsen says TV still reaches many. 90% of U.S. adults watch it. So TV is a key tool for artists. Gaga uses this wide reach. She performs on big shows. She does interviews to share her art. Her message gets out there. These TV spots really help sales. Album sales and streams go up. Its a proven way to connect.
